Here’s a scrumptious, quick-and-easy recipe for cottage pie.
Ingredients
- 6 medium potatoes
- milk and butter for the mash
- 500g lean mince
- 1 onion, chopped
- 4 cloves of garlic, crushed
- 2 tomatoes, chopped
- 1 carrot, chopped
- 1 beef stock cube dissolved in ½ cup boiling water
- 1 Tbsp sunflower oil for frying
- 3-4 Tbsp tomato paste
- ½ tsp dried thyme
- salt and pepper to taste
- ½ cup grated cheese to sprinkle on top of mash (optional)
Method
Peel the potatoes, slice in half and boil until soft for about a half hour.
Sauté the onion and garlic in the cooking oil. Add the mince and fry while removing lumps with a fork. Once the mince is browned add tomatoes, tomato paste, salt, pepper and thyme. Add the stock cube and water. Mix together well. Simmer for 10 to 15 minutes or until water is absorbed. Spoon the mixture into a casserole dish.
Mash the potatoes, add some milk and butter to create a soft even consistency (no lumps). Spread the mash potato evenly over the mince mixture and sprinkle with cheese. Place the dish under the grill for a few minutes and allow the cheese to melt and the mash to turn golden brown.
